On December 6, 2024, Idaho Power Company ("Company") filed an application ("Application") with the Idaho Public Utilities Commission ("Commission") requesting an order approving the Special Contract for electric service between the Company and Micron Idaho Semiconductor Manufacturing (Triton) LLC ("Micron"), for Micron's new memory manufacturing fabrication complex ("Micron FAB"), and approving the rates proposed in tariff Schedule 28. Application at 1. On January 27, 2025, the Commission issued a Notice of Application and Notice of Modified Procedure establishing a March 12, 2025, initial comment deadline, and a March 26, 2025, reply comment deadline. Order No. 36446. The Commission granted intervention to Micron Technology, Inc. ("Micron"), the Idaho Irrigation Pumpers Association, Inc. ("IIPA"), and the Industrial Customers of Idaho Power ("ICIP"). Order Nos. 36460, 36479, 36483. OBJECTION AND MOTION On February 20, 2025, IIPA filed an Objection to Modified Procedure, Demand for Hearing, and Motion to Consolidate for Hearing with Interrelated Cases ("Motion"). IIPA requested oral argument on the Motion. DECISION MEMORANDUM 1 STAFF RECOMMENDATION Commission Staff("Staff')recommends that the Commission establish a schedule for oral argument, or any other procedure deemed necessary by the Commission. Staff also recommends the Commission vacate the current comment deadlines in Order No. 36446 and set a new procedural schedule upon resolution of the Motion. COMMISSION DECISION Does the Commission wish to: 1. Set a schedule for oral argument or other procedure? 2. Vacate the current comment deadlines and set a new procedural schedule upon resolution of the Motion?
